H-1B Job Board

Finding companies that sponsor visas is a lot of work.
We've made your life easier by compiling top companies and startups that hire foreign nationals.

Lead Cloud GCP Systems Engineer

EPAM Systems

EPAM Systems

Software Engineering
Remote
Posted on Oct 1, 2024

Lead Cloud GCP Systems Engineer Description

EPAM is a leading global provider of digital platform engineering and development services. We are committed to having a positive impact on our customers, our employees, and our communities. We embrace a dynamic and inclusive culture. Here you will collaborate with multi-national teams, contribute to a myriad of innovative projects that deliver the most creative and cutting-edge solutions, and have an opportunity to continuously learn and grow. No matter where you are located, you will join a dedicated, creative, and diverse community that will help you discover your fullest potential.

We are seeking a talented Lead Cloud GCP Engineer to join our team and contribute to the design, implementation, and management of Google Cloud Platform (GCP) solutions.

If you are passionate about cloud technologies, infrastructure as code, and optimizing cloud-based environments, this role offers an exciting opportunity to shape our cloud strategy and drive innovation. We require an experienced Architect who can contribute to critical application and product development projects.


#LI-DNI#EasyApply

Technologies

  • GCP
  • Linux
  • Networking
  • CI/CD
  • Jenkins
  • Docker
  • Kubernetes
  • Terraform/Ansible
  • Python/shell

Responsibilities

  • Collaborate closely with the Cloud Architect to lead the development of automation for deploying production workloads in our cloud environment
  • Provide first-tier support for both internal and external users
  • Design, install, configure, maintain cloud resources, and develop recovery strategies
  • Monitor and evaluate to ensure timely upgrades and additions of IaaS/PaaS and software to meet growth requirements
  • Ensure fault-tolerance, high-availability, scalability, and security on Google Cloud infrastructure and platform
  • Implement CI/CD pipelines with automated build and testing systems
  • Manage Production Deployment using Multiple Deployment Strategies
  • Automate Google Cloud Infrastructure and Platform Deployment using Infrastructure as Code
  • Automate system configurations using configuration management tools
  • Implement Microservices Concepts and Best Practices
  • Enable application development by coordinating requirements, schedules, and activities
  • Address issues promptly and respond positively to setbacks and challenges with a mindset of continuous improvement
  • Carry out POCs to verify that design and technologies meet the requirements
  • Quickly learn services used in the environment

Requirements

  • Overall 8 to 12 years of experience with a minimum 5 years in production on public cloud platforms
  • Leadership traits and at least 2 years of team-leading experience
  • Proficiency in GCP Architecture, and Security, Networks, Hybrid Cloud
  • Experience with GCP Services - Compute, Storage, Data tools, and Cloud Build
  • Skills in GCP Networking and Security fundamentals
  • Understanding of Container Orchestration and Container Registry - GCR
  • Set up of Load Balancer, Auto Scaling, databases, and firewall rules
  • Working knowledge of Backup and Recovery methods on GCP
  • Familiarity with Infrastructure as Code using tools like Terraform
  • Competency with configuration management tools such as Ansible, Packer, or Salt
  • Proficiency in containerization with Dockers and Kubernetes
  • Background in Windows or Linux/Unix administration and Unix shell scripting
  • Experience with CI/CD Pipelines and related tools like GitLab, Jenkins, or Bamboo
  • Capability to migrate and modernize workloads into GCP
  • Knowledge of GCP migration tools such as Migration Center and Database Migration Service

Nice to have

  • Coding experience with modern languages such as Python, Groovy
  • Application development experience

We offer

  • Opportunity to work on technical challenges that may impact across geographies
  • Vast opportunities for self-development: online university, knowledge sharing opportunities globally, learning opportunities through external certifications
  • Opportunity to share your ideas on international platforms
  • Sponsored Tech Talks & Hackathons
  • Unlimited access to LinkedIn learning solutions
  • Possibility to relocate to any EPAM office for short and long-term projects
  • Focused individual development
  • Benefit package:
    • Health benefits
    • Retirement benefits
    • Paid time off
    • Flexible benefits
  • Forums to explore beyond work passion (CSR, photography, painting, sports, etc.)